So, 'The Devil's in the Details'—it's an interesting piece from 2013 that plays with tension in a really tight timeframe. The setup is simple but effective; we’re looking at a guy, Thomas Conrad, who gets tangled up in a pretty intense scenario involving a drug cartel. The pacing is brisk, and you really feel the clock ticking down those seven minutes. The atmosphere is heavy, darkly saturated, which adds to this sense of impending doom. The performances, while not from big names, feel raw and grounded, which enhances the immersive experience. What stands out is how it uses minimal practical effects but still manages to grip you. It rings with themes of desperation and survival, resonating with the gritty reality of the drug trade.
